Output ad8b60de3a4d4fabacb7dcfbbcc35aaab1a14340614a3197540bd2b8d0597d4f:1

value
420000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 70ee77d2fa504c8269f5352e0064db005aa36fb9 OP_EQUAL
address
3Bz9H5cECTktW2oBcmepmtBZNtFR67YMM8
transaction
ad8b60de3a4d4fabacb7dcfbbcc35aaab1a14340614a3197540bd2b8d0597d4f
confirmations
262962
spent
true